#219: Kristen Ford - How to tour Europe without a booking agent or label

Kristen FordThe European market has a rich live-music tradition, but artists often feel lost when trying to infiltrate the scene as an outsider. However, with the aid of online tools like Google Translate and Skype, booking your own successful European tour might be easier than you think. In this session, recorded live at the 2018 DIY Musician Conference, Kristen talks Euro-tour logistics including accepting payments, renting music equipment, lodging, meals, merchandise, arranging a vehicle or cheap flights, busking, and non-traditional venues. Making music has never been easier, but building a music career today is altogether different. Finding the right audience for your music takes an entrepreneurial mindset, a lot of hard work, and a willingness to experiment. The DIY Musician Podcast features interviews with artists of all styles and backgrounds who’ve found a unique but authentic pathway to success, as well as in-depth discussions with music publicists, promoters, lawyers, publishers, talent buyers, and more. This podcast is geared towards independent musicians who want to build a sustainable music career without giving up (too much) financial or creative control. Hosts Kevin and Chris work with hundreds of thousands of artists at CD Baby, and are actively releasing and promoting their own music too; they're part of the same community they’re helping to educate and encourage with each new episode.
